Herbster, a community in Bayfield County, Wisconsin, has 109 residents. At $66,250, its median household income sits below Bayfield County's $69,609.
From 2019 to 2023, Herbster's population held roughly steady from 108 to 109, while its median home value rose 71.5% from $200,000 to $342,900.
The median resident is 62.3 years old. The largest age group is 75 and over, 22.9% of residents.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 108 | $42,321 | $200,000 |
| 2020 | 83 | $53,333 | $258,300 |
| 2021 | 85 | $52,500 | $260,000 |
| 2022 | 107 | $61,250 | $312,500 |
| 2023 | 109 | $66,250 | $342,900 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
